Leica V-Lux 40 vs Samsung TL220 Physical Comparison

If you are going to travel with your camera, you will want to factor in its weight and proportions. The Leica V-Lux 40 has outer dimensions of 105mm x 59mm x 28m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.1") with a weight of 210 grams (0.46 lbs) and the Samsung TL220 has measurements of 100mm x 60mm x 19mm (3.9" x 2.4" x 0.7") and a weight of 169 grams (0.37 lbs).

Leica V-Lux 40 vs Samsung TL220 Sensor Comparison

More often than not, it's tough to visualise the contrast between sensor dimensions just by going over a spec sheet. The picture here may offer you a more clear sense of the sensor sizes in the V-Lux 40 and TL220.

Clearly, both of the cameras come with the identical sensor size albeit not the same megapixels. You should expect the Leica V-Lux 40 to offer greater detail as a result of its extra 2 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also let you crop photographs a good deal more aggressively. The more recent V-Lux 40 is going to have an advantage with regard to sensor tech.
